Oatmeal cooking up on the stove always smells delicious and with adding pumpkin and pumpkin pie spice to it makes the aroma heavenly. As much as I love oatmeal I've never thought to put pumpkin in with it. The taste is sweet and yet light and would be perfect served for any occasion. This would be lovely with some dried cranberries and nuts too.

yield 2 serving(s)
prep time 5 Min
cook time 20 Min
method Stove Top

Ingredients For cinderella's oatmeal

  • 2 c
    organic milk
  • 1/2 c
    organic canned 100% pure pumpkin puree
  • 1 Tbsp
    sucanat (or substitute light brown sugar)
  • 1/2 tsp
    pumpkin pie spice
  • 3/4 c
    old-fashioned rolled oats

How To Make cinderella's oatmeal

  • 1
    Whisk milk, pumpkin puree, brown sugar, and pumpkin pie spice in a small saucepan. Cover and bring it to a gentle boil over medium-low heat.
  • 2
    Once the milk mixture starts to create bubbles around the edges of the pot (about 4-5minutes), stir in the oats. Cook according to the package directions. Oats should be soft and creamy. Remove the pot from heat, cover, and let it stand for at least 15 minutes, or until oatmeal thickens and cools.
